THE desperation level of a Sydney reality TV personality has hit an all-time low.

Married At First Sight participant Nasser Sultan proved he has no shame, this week begging to be allowed into an event for which he was not on the guest list.

Sultan, who appeared on the latest season of the controversial dating show, fronted up to MTV’s Peking Duk event at the Commune in Waterloo on Tuesday night.

When Sultan reached the door, he was embarrassingly not on the list. With the conversation between Sultan and the event team going back and forth, he appeared to have conceded and retreated, before returning again.

Confidential’s sources said Sultan asked: “Can I please just go onto the media wall and have my photo taken then I will leave”.

Further enquiries by Confidential showed Sultan was in fact invited but that the venue was full, meaning dozens were left waiting outside. Sultan was one of those and after his begging to be allowed inside, organisers allowed him to stay.

The shameless self-promoter added the negotiated photo to Instagram, tagging the humorous picture, “Jumpin into the A-list like…”.

Unsurprisingly he did not explain the lengths he went to have the photo taken.

His desperation could be linked to his very public campaign to be given an Instagram blue tick — reserved for high-profile users.

Sultan was in hot water last week after it was revealed he had been hunting down his haters and calling them at work. It is understood he even called the school of a 12-year-old girl who had left a nasty post to “dob” on her.

Confidential attempted to contact Sultan several times by phone but he did not return calls.
